When Your Garage Door Is Malfunctioning: Signs You Need Garage Door Repair

Your garage door can show subtle signs that it is about to break, and it's useful to pay attention to these signs. You can end up with a door that malfunctions completely, making it difficult to get in and out of your garage. If your garage door is abnormally slow while opening, doesn't stay in the open position, or makes loud noises when moving, it's time to investigate further. Issues with your garage door springs, opener, tracks, or wheels can all cause problems that need to be repaired. If you notice changes to how your door opens and closes, a garage door repair technician should be called to come to figure out what is wrong.

Issues With Your Garage Door Springs 

It is important to your safety that you do not touch garage door springs on your own. These are tightly coiled springs that can snap if you adjust them too tightly. Problems with your garage door springs manifest when you notice that the garage door won't stay open, or the opener is straining with the heavy weight of your door. Although your problem could be the opener itself, loose tension springs won't hold the weight of the door as it opens. If you notice a slow-moving door, it's time to have your springs adjusted.

Your Door Changes Direction

If you notice that your garage door changes direction midstream, this might be a quick fix. Check your garage door tracks to see if there is anything in the way. Sometimes a bracket will come off that holds your track in place, causing an imbalance in the two tracks. If the door changes direction when it is almost closed, something could be in the way of one of your photo eyes. If you can't figure out why the door keeps changing direction, it's time for a repair.

The Opener Is Straining

Your garage door opener will start to strain if it is failing, or if the springs are not holding the weight of the door. The problem might be a combination of the two issues, and you may need to have your springs adjusted and a new opener installed. Don't keep running a garage door opener that is struggling, as you can burn out the opener before it needed to be replaced.
